Think about the two texts you read in this lesson and how they present different aspects of the same story. How did reading both

texts enrich your understanding of Iqbal’s story?

The texts revealed different ideas about Iqbal’s story. The graphic version helped give a visualization of the setting, people, etc. The memoir version showed that there are many unknown details about Iqbal’s life, but that the important thing is for people to take action on the issue at hand.
